O Level Chemistry Question: Electrolysis / Mole Concepts / Mole Calculations

Hey student,

Here is another one for you to think about. Yup. O Level Preliminary Chemistry question. Think about it and let me know.

Question:
A certain quantity of electricity liberates 9g of aluminiun. The volume of oxygen liberated at r.t.p from dilute sulphuric acid by the same quantity of electricity is:

A)6 dm^3
B)8 dm^3
C)12 dm^3
D)24 dm^3
